Because it wasn't entirely clear here, I don't think it is a bug that
the source packages contain actually the the code; it's only a bug if
they actually use it in the building process.  I don't think it's at all
useful to contact upstreams about embedded copies of code, as long as it's
possible to specify a systme-wide version at build-time.  Everybody wins
that way.
